P1CA1
Gear Shift Position Sensor 3 Circuit
P1CA1 is an OBD-II diagnostic trouble code meaning: Gear Shift Position Sensor 3 Circuit. Common causes: open or short circuit in the sensor circuit, gear position sensor 3 malfunction. Estimated repair cost: $17–56.
Symptoms
- Incorrect gear shifting
- Transmission transition to emergency mode
- Check Engine Light Illuminates
- Loss of engine power
- Problems starting the engine
Causes
- Open or short circuit in the sensor circuit
- Gear Position Sensor 3 Malfunction
- Oxidation or damage to connectors
- Problems with the transmission control unit
- Mechanical damage to wiring
How to Fix
- Check the integrity of the sensor circuit
- Inspect connectors for damage
- Check sensor resistance
- Replace gear position sensor 3 if necessary
- Clean or replace damaged connectors
